I am pleased to announce that Dave Sunderland has agreed to co-ordinate the selection of England teams and development events for emerging talent until the new Coaching and Development manager takes up his or her role, reports Mike Summers, England Athletics, CEO.
Selection
He will co-ordinate selection with UK Athletics, liaise with competition providers both at home and abroad, identify competitive opportunities for those athletes and events that we wish to support, identify up and coming team managers, etc.
This will be predominately Track and Field although if any advice is needed on the endurance events bearing in mind his experience then I am sure that he will willingly give it.
Credentials
Dave's credentials are impressive. He has held several National Coach roles, including Middle Distance (2004-2006), Steeplechase (1990-1998) and Long Distance Junior (1983-1990). He has organised numerous major events including National Cross Country and Inter County Champs.
He has coached many athletes to international honours, including one world record holder and five european medalists. He has acted as Team Coach at two Olympics, four World Championships and two Commonwealth Games. He has lectured and run courses across the world and is the author of "High Performance Middle Distance Running".
